    Eloquii

    After a three-year hiatus, Eloquii has returned with a swimwear line that boasts the same quality and style as its standard offerings. The Eloquii swimwear line features 43 styles, including one-pieces, bikinis, cover-ups, and more, in sizes 12 to 28. The plus size line boasts a flattering cut and style that caters to the curves and contours of the body.

    Cacique

    From its lingerie to its swimwear, Lane Bryant’s Cacique has been fitting plus-size women for decades. The Cacique plus size swimwear line features an array of options for both band and cup sizes, with styles available for sizes 14 to 28. Cup sizes range from C to H, with band sizes 36-46. There are also swimsuits that feature plus-size straps. Whether you want a low-cut, one-piece style, or a bikini top, Cacique has got you covered.
